Output 89c67a80c5bb299903cfc9b75c8251d71c0e888d9fe1c8c03e216fe004555fad:1

value
522433
script pubkey
OP_0 OP_PUSHBYTES_32 853db26082b0a544146da268f1780cff1b6b61de3187fdddcb62cee24dabf19f
address
bc1qs57mycyzkzj5g9rd5f50z7qvludkkcw7xxrlmhwtvt8wyndt7x0sttcede
transaction
89c67a80c5bb299903cfc9b75c8251d71c0e888d9fe1c8c03e216fe004555fad
confirmations
274686
spent
true